Job Purpose<br><br>Responsible for interpreting Flight Data Monitoring (FDM) and operational safety data to identify hazards, assess operational risks, and support proactive safety management across the Air Arabia Group. Provides operational expertise for safety investigations, risk assessments, crew engagement, and safety promotion activities, ensuring effective risk mitigation and continuous enhancement of flight safety and operational performance.<br><br>Key Result Responsibilities<br><br>Serve as the Flight Operations interpreter within the Air Arabia Group Flight Data Monitoring (FDM) Program by providing accurate operational interpretation of FDM exceedances, trends, SOP application, aircraft handling characteristics, and operational context. Conduct proactive monitoring and analysis of FDM and other safety data to identify operational trends, recurring exceedances, emerging threats, operational hazards, and associated safety risks. Perform operational risk assessments, evaluate the effectiveness of existing risk controls and mitigation measures, monitor implemented safety actions, and recommend additional mitigations where required. Carry out timely review, assessment, follow-up, and closure of safety reports submitted by flight crew in accordance with proactive safety management principles and Just Culture requirements, determining their operational significance and safety implications. <br><br>Key Result Responsibilities - Continued<br><br>Develop safety recommendations to address identified risks and prevent recurrence of safety events. Lead and participate in crew engagement activities and crew debriefing sessions to gather operational insights, reinforce safety culture, and close the feedback loop on safety findings. Actively participate in Air Arabia safety promotion activities, including drafting safety publications and planning Safety Walk & Talk sessions. Support Safety Risk Assessments (SRA) and Management of Change (MOC) activities by identifying operational hazards and emerging risks.<br><br>Qualifications (Academic, Training, Languages)<br><br>Commercial airline pilot with extensive knowledge of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), operational procedures, Airbus aircraft systems, aircraft handling characteristics, and flight operations. Good Knowledge of ICAO Annex 19 Safety Management principles. Strong understanding of GCAA CAR SMS and CAR AIR OPS requirements. Good knowledge of Flight Data Monitoring (FDM/FOQA) principles. Understanding of Human Factors and Threat & Error Management. Knowledge of operational risk assessment methodologies. Excellent operational judgement. Strong analytical and problem-solving skills. Ability to conduct crew interviews and operational debriefings. Strong attention to detail and accuracy and report writing Ability to analyze large volumes of operational safety data. Strong stakeholder engagement and interpersonal skills. High level of integrity, professionalism and confidentiality. Proactive safety mindset aligned with Just Culture principles. Fluent in English and any other languages required.<br><br>Work Experience<br><br>With a minimum of 5+ years of commercial airline flight operations experience. Strong familiarity with the route network, aerodromes, and operating environment. Previous experience as a Training Captain, TRI/TRE, or in-Flight Safety, Flight Data Monitoring (FDM), Flight Operations Quality Assurance (FOQA), or related aviation safety functions is an advantage.

<p>Job Purpose
To lead sales growth and market expansion for FMCG food products (Milk Powder, Jam, Tomato Paste) across Africa, GCC, and other international regions by developing new markets, acquiring
new customers, and managing existing business relationships to achieve company targets.
Core Criteria Overview
1. Open new markets (not just maintain existing ones).
2. Understand African business culture and logistics.
3. Build and manage distributor networks.
4. Handle export documentation, pricing, and payment terms.
5. Represent the company professionally and grow the brand regionally.
Market Experience & Regional Knowledge
Must have prior experience selling to African markets (North, West, or East Africa).
1. Preferably in FMCG food or dairy sectors.
2. Understands import regulations, trade barriers, and logistics routes for Africa.
3. Familiar with distribution structures (importers, wholesalers, sub-distributors).
4. Knows how to adapt pricing and product strategy for markets with currency and demand variations.
Product-Specific Experience
Experience in FMCG food categories, and knowledge of competitors especially:
1. Milk powder / dairy (understanding of reconstitution, packaging formats, and shelf-life).
2. Tomato paste & jam (familiarity with tin, sachet, and jar packaging formats).
3. Evaporated milk (future line).
Distributor Development Skills.
Must know how to:
1. Identify and appoint reliable distributors or agents.
2. Negotiate trade terms (pricing, credit, and marketing support).
3. Establish exclusive agreements with performance clauses.
4. Support distributors in sales planning, stock management, and local promotions.
Sales & Business Development Competence. Proven ability to:
5. Prospect new customers and expand distribution networks.
6. Negotiate and close large-volume contracts.
7. Prepare sales forecasts and annual budgets.
8. Achieve or exceed export sales targets.
Export Process & Documentation Knowledge.
Understanding of:
1. Incoterms, LC (Letter of Credit), CAD, advance payments, and credit terms.
2. Shipping documentation (Invoice, Packing List, Certificate of Origin, Bill of Lading, etc.).
3. Product registration requirements (especially for dairy products in African countries).
4. Coordination with logistics, finance, and customs clearance agents.
Language & Communication:
1. English: Essential (for East & Anglophone Africa)
2. French: Highly preferred (for West & North Africa)
3. Arabic: Advantageous (for North Africa & GCC coordination)
Cultural Awareness & Adaptability. Must be able to:
1. Travel frequently and adapt to different African business environments.
2. Respect local business etiquette, timing, and negotiation styles.
3. Handle diverse challenges (logistics delays, pricing volatility, import regulations).
Commercial & Analytical Skills. Should be able to:
1. Analyze market trends, competitor pricing, and consumer behavior.
2. Recommend pricing strategies and promotional activities.
3. Understand profit margins, trade costs, and cost-to-serve per market.</p><p>Required Qualifications:
1. Bachelor Degree in Business, Marketing, or International Trade.
2. Minimum 4? 6 years of export sales or business development experience in the FMCG / food
sector.
3. Proven record of opening new markets and acquiring new customers in Africa or GCC.
4. Strong network of distributors or importers in the region is an advantage.</p>
